ORDER
The proposed findings and partial recommendations (“PRD”) submitted by United
States Magistrate Judge Jerome T. Kearney and plaintiff Michael Muhammad’s objections
thereto have been reviewed. After careful consideration of these documents and a de novo
review of the record, the PRD are hereby adopted in all respects. Moreover, pursuant to
Muhammad’s request, Dr. Steve is dismissed as a defendant. See Doc. No. 6.
IT IS THEREFORE ORDERED that:
1
Muhammad’s claims against defendants K. Hardgrave, CCS, and A. Gray are
dismissed with prejudice.
2
Pursuant to Muhammad’s request, Dr. Steve is voluntarily dismissed with
prejudice.
IT IS SO ORDERED this 28th day of October 2015.
